The Indiana Pacers and the Oklahoma City Thunder wrapped up the 2025 NBA Finals in game seven at Paycom Center in Oklahoma.
The series was tied up 3-3 heading into game seven with the Thunder being the favorites. Many weren’t expecting the Pacers to make it to game seven with many critics taking Indiana for the upset if they were able to push the series to game seven.
Unfortunately for the Pacers they fell short after having a terrible third quarter where they were outscored 34-20 which turned out the be the difference in the game. The Oklahoma City Thunder added their second championship to their trophy case, their first since 1979.
In other sports, the Colorado Rockies won game three of a three game series with the Arizona Diamondbacks to prevent a three-game sweep giving the Rockies their 18th win of the season with 60 losses.
This week the Rockies host the division leading L.A. Dodgers in a three-game series before heading to Milwaukee to face the Brewers in a three game series.
The Rockies are 29.5 games behind the division leading L.A. Dodgers and 22 games behind the second to last place Arizona Diamondbacks. Despite the Rockies terrible season, Coors Field still seems to fill up with fans who have accepted them as the worst in the league.
